Job Title: Network Engineer/JAS
Job Location: NJ: Hackensack
Pay Rate: 120K
Job Length: full time
Start Date: 2008-09-15

Company Name: Shain Associates
Contact: John Santiago
Phone: 732-248-8222
Fax: 732-248-1082

Description: The Network Engineer will become a member of the network team. His/her primary responsibility is the management of the network infrastructure for a large server farm and mainframe environment that is accessible from a number of remote locations. He/she will: Provide troubleshooting and maintenance services for a LAN//WAN network infrastructure; Review, test and execute configuration tasks that enhance reliability and redundancy, increase bandwidth, improve traffic flow, and ensure the maximum availability of the network infrastructure; Design and configure settings for switches and routers in multi-protocol inter-networks; Carry out performance, security monitoring, and documentation of the relevant network segments to ensure data integrity and environmental safety; Assist customers with determining their requirements for network performance, security, capacity and scalability; Provide high-level design services for inter- network architecture, which could include LANs, routed and switched WANs, and remote access networks; Conduct network baselines and make necessary recommendations.
